I am trying to find out more about a relative. ERNEST JOSEPH COUSINS of the King's (Liverpool Regiment) 7th Battalion. He was born in Wexford in 1897 and died on 28th June 1916. He was killed in action in France and Flanders.

If I have the right one, he is on CWGC as Joseph Ernest Cousins:

http://www.cwgc.org/search/casualty_details.aspx?casualty=35875

On SDGW as Ernest Joseph Cousins, born Kilmore, Wexford.

On his medal index card he is Ernest Cousins.

His service record is on Ancestry, but says that he was born in Bootle.
